Transaction 3bf44ec5c74002374c6c73aa61373702598785e9f90bec4035a3e6ce65ed896a

2 Input
2 Outputs
  • 3bf44ec5c74002374c6c73aa61373702598785e9f90bec4035a3e6ce65ed896a:0
  • value  675883257
    address  165DBHkwus2CgfXNjXYvA4Tr4qGvfxiDLg
  • 3bf44ec5c74002374c6c73aa61373702598785e9f90bec4035a3e6ce65ed896a:1
  • value  21640000
    address  1H8aP7oK8KKpfYfNNjB9tEBNMVStPXki2j